Title: To authorize the appropriation and transfer of $161,140.00 from within the Sewer System Permanent Improvements Fund; and the appropriation of $356,669.03 from within the Ohio Water Pollution Control Loan Fund in connection with four sanitary sewer relief projects located within the North Linden community; for the Division of Sewerage and Drainage, and to declare an emergency. ($161,140.00)
Explanation
1. BACKGROUND:
This legislation will authorize the appropriation and transfer of funds within the Sewer System Permanent Improvements Fund for purposes of establishing funding for the City's ineligible costs associated with four sanitary sewer relief projects located within the North Linden community. The Ohio EPA has determined that pavement related items are ineligible for funding, and it is therefore the City's responsibility of fund these items with other funding.

This legislation will also authorize the appropriation of proceeds from an existing Ohio Water Development Authority loan proceeds which are needed to allow for the procurement of construction administration and inspection services that are being requested within companion legislation.

2. FISCAL IMPACT:
This legislation will enable the Division of Sewerage and Drainage to facilitate an adjustment to existing City Auditor's Contract No. EL005013 with the Complete General Construction Company, by canceling the ineligible funds from the OWDA funded contracts and replacing them with Sewer System Permanent Improvement Funds.

3. EMERGENCY LEGISLATION:
The Division of Sewerage and Drainage is requesting City Council to consider this legislation an emergency measure in order to allow the financial transaction to be posted in the City's accounting system as soon as possible. Up to date financial posting promotes accurate accounting and financial management.
